Understanding the Hot Cold Delay in Dewalt Chargers

The hot cold delay feature on Dewalt chargers is designed to protect lithium-ion batteries from damage caused by extreme temperatures. When the charger detects that the battery is either too hot or too cold, it will enter delay mode. During this time, the charger will not charge the battery, which can be frustrating during urgent tasks.

Steps to Fix Hot Cold Delay on Dewalt Charger

Here’s an in-depth guide on how to troubleshoot and fix the hot cold delay issue on your Dewalt charger.

Step 1: Assess the Environment

Before anything else, ensure that both the charger and battery are used in a proper environment. For optimal performance, the ideal temperature range for charging lithium-ion batteries is between 32°F (0°C) and 113°F (45°C).

  • Temperature Check: Make sure you’re working in an environment that meets these temperature parameters. If your surroundings are too hot or cold, move the charger to a more suitable location.

What causes the hot cold delay on Dewalt chargers?

The hot cold delay on Dewalt chargers is primarily a safety feature designed to protect the battery from damage due to extreme temperatures. If the charger detects that the battery temperature is too hot or too cold, it will enter a delay mode, which prevents charging until the battery reaches a safe temperature range. This is crucial for maintaining battery health and longevity.

Moreover, the delay can be influenced by external factors such as environmental conditions and battery condition. If the battery has been left in a hot or freezing location, it may trigger the delay even if the charging station itself is functioning properly. Understanding this feature helps users optimize their charging practices and ensure their batteries are charged safely.

What should I do if my charger is constantly in hot cold delay mode?

If your Dewalt charger consistently remains in hot cold delay mode, it may indicate a problem with the charger itself or the battery. First, check if the battery is functioning correctly. If possible, try using another battery with the same charger to see if the delay issue persists. This step will help you determine if the fault lies with the battery or the charger.

If the charger continues to experience delays with multiple batteries, it may require professional evaluation. Check the charger for any visible damage or wear that might be affecting its performance. In some cases, it may need to be repaired or replaced to ensure efficient operation.

Will using an extension cord affect the charger’s performance?

Using an extension cord can potentially affect the performance of your Dewalt charger depending on the cord’s quality and specifications. If the extension cord is too long or not rated for the power needs of the charger, it can lead to voltage drops and insufficient power delivery, which may cause the charger to perform inefficiently or trigger safety features such as hot cold delays.

When using an extension cord, ensure it is heavy-duty and appropriately rated for the charger’s amperage requirements. Shorter, high-quality extension cords designed for power tools will offer better performance and reliability, ensuring that your charger works efficiently without interruptions.
